The daughter of former Prime Minister Tony Abbott has announced she is engaged - after just two weeks of dating her new love interest.
Frances Abbott shared photo booth picture strips of herself and Olympic rower Sam Loch, 34, to her Instagram account on Sunday evening, adding the engagement notice in the caption.
'Hey Feyonce,' she wrote.
'Two weeks was all it took to know that forever with you was a mighty fine idea.'
Ms Abbott added hashtags reading: 'why wait', 'he liked it so he put a ring on it' and 'let's do this'.
No image has emerged of the ring.

The announcement was met with a mix of shock and excitement by the competitive bodybuilder's followers.
A journalist for Harper's Bazaar who recently interviewed Ms Abbott was more shocked than most.
'Whoa! Things change quickly,' wrote Rachelle Unreich.
'When I interviewed you not very long ago for Harper's, you said you were sooooo single! Congrats! Wishing you a lifetime of happiness.'

The 26-year-old has undergone a drastic transformation since taking up professional bodybuilding.
Last year, she competed and recently told Daily Mail Australia the competitions were an 'exciting experiment' for herself.
She recently made headlines for her publicly stating she supported marriage equality, while her politician father stood firmly against it, despite his sister being in a high-profile same sex relationship.
Ms Abbott told Daily Mail Australia earlier this month the debate could rage on between the highly passionate members of her family, but would all be set aside at the dinner table.

'Politics is one of those things,' she said. 'It's hard to avoid when it comes to my family, but we love each other.
'We will politely agree to disagree and I guess that's the same with most families. You're like: "I'll give you the stink eye across the table, but that's about it".'
When asked about Tony and his sister, Christine Forster, disagreeing, Frances said: 'Of course it's set aside when we sit down. It's all: "Hey", "Hey".'
Ms Abbott recently worked for the marriage equality campaign, which she said was 'interesting':
'For me, it seems so obvious,' she explained.
'I don't really understand why it's a debate. It was great working with the equality campaign. It's time for change.'
Sam Loch, her new fiance, holds multiple world records for rowing, and has competed in the Beijing and London Olympics.
Both Ms Abbott and Mr Loch are understood to work as personal trainers in Melbourne.
No announcement has been posted to Mr Loch's Instagram, though he is an avid user of the platform, often sharing videos demonstrating his super-human strength.
Daily Mail Australia has contacted Ms Abbott for comment.
